Tuesday 1st April 2025: 280 store cattle in Ballymena on Tuesday resulted in another terrific trade. Heifers sold to £2160 over for a Charolais 610kg £2790 offered by John McIlrath, Ballymena.
Fleshed Friesian cows sold to £2329 for an 850kg to £274 per 100kg. Fat bulls sold to £3660 for a 1220kg Limousin to £300 per 100kg with a 1030kg Charolais to £3028-20 at £294 per 100kg. Fat ...
